Fashion manufacturing has always balanced two competing demands: creative, detailed design work, and the practical need for speed and consistency at scale.

Embroidery machines, particularly computerized single and multi-head systems, have become one of the quiet but significant forces reshaping how that balance is achieved across India's textile and garment sector.

From artisan-dependent to technology-supported production. Traditionally, intricate embroidery work depended almost entirely on skilled artisans working by hand a process that's beautiful but difficult to scale predictably. Computerized embroidery machines haven't replaced that artistry; they've extended it, allowing digitized versions of traditional and modern designs to be reproduced consistently at a pace manual work alone couldn't sustainably match for larger production runs.

Enabling small manufacturers to compete with larger players. One of the more significant shifts has been accessibility. As embroidery machines, including relatively affordable single head embroidery machine options, have become more widely available, smaller manufacturers and independent embropreneurs have gained the ability to produce embroidery work that once required large-scale factory setups, narrowing the gap between small businesses and bigger manufacturing units.

Supporting faster fashion cycles: Fashion trends move quickly, and manufacturers increasingly need to turn around embroidered garments faster than traditional hand-work timelines allow. Computerized machines significantly compress production time for detailed embroidery work, helping manufacturers keep pace with shorter design-to-market cycles without compromising on design complexity.

Improving consistency for brand reputation: For fashion brands working with embroidered garments, consistency across production runs is critical to maintaining quality perception. Computerized embroidery reduces the natural variation of hand-stitched work, helping manufacturers deliver uniform quality across large order volumes, something increasingly important as brands scale into wider retail and export markets.

Opening new design possibilities: Digitized embroidery also enables design experimentation that would be time-prohibitive by hand testing variations, combining traditional motifs with modern layouts, or adjusting scale and placement digitally before committing to production. This has quietly expanded the creative range available to fashion manufacturers working within realistic time and cost constraints.

Supporting India's textile export ambitions: As Indian textile and garment manufacturers compete in global export markets, consistent quality and reliable turnaround times matter as much as design appeal. The growing adoption of computerized embroidery machines across manufacturing hubs is helping Indian producers meet the quality and delivery expectations of international buyers more predictably than manual-only production allowed.

A shift, not a replacement, for traditional craftsmanship. It's worth noting that this shift hasn't eliminated hand embroidery; high-end, heavily customized, or heritage craftsmanship still commands a market of its own. Instead, computerized machines have primarily transformed the mid-to-large volume segment of the industry, where consistency, speed, and cost efficiency matter most.

As more manufacturers, from large factories to independent single-machine entrepreneurs, adopt this technology, embroidery machines are likely to remain one of the quieter but genuinely transformative forces shaping how Indian fashion manufacturing scales in the years ahead.
